📅  最后修改于: 2023-12-03 15:11:20.371000             🧑  作者: Mango
如果你需要添加新的运营商(例如移动运营商),可以按照以下步骤进行操作。
首先,你需要在代码中添加新的 API。这个过程非常简单,只需要按照既定的格式添加即可。
例如,如果你需要添加移动运营商,可以在代码中添加以下 API:
class MobileOperator(BaseOperator):
def __init__(self, **kwargs):
super().__init__(**kwargs)
def send_message(self, message):
# 发送短信
pass
def dial(self, phone_number):
# 拨打电话
pass
def send_data(self, data):
# 发送数据
pass
接下来,你需要在配置文件中添加你的新运营商。在大多数情况下,这个文件是 YAML 文件。你应该在其中添加相应的内容,包括名字和 API。
例如:
- name: MobileOperator
class: MobileOperator
最后,你应该测试你的运营商是否正常工作。你可以使用相应的测试脚本来测试你的代码是否工作正常。
import myapp
# 创建移动运营商的实例
mobile_operator = myapp.create_operator("MobileOperator")
# 测试发送短信
mobile_operator.send_message("Hello, World!")
# 测试拨打电话
mobile_operator.dial("12345678901")
# 测试发送数据
mobile_operator.send_data(b"Hello, World!")
这些步骤应该足以帮助你添加新的运营商到你的程序中。希望你能够成功!